1. Tying your hair up in a tight ponytail
Yes, tying your hair up in a tight ponytail is cool cause’ you’ll feel like Ariana Grande. However, it’s not a good thing you should do to your hair on a daily basis as it causes stress on your hair which causes breakage and ugly split ends. We would suggest you tie your hair a bit looser so that your hair can breathe.
2. Using Too Much Heat on Your Hair
Straightening or curling your hair daily is not a good idea as you’re applying heat that would damage your hair that causes hair burnout. Not only that, hair dryers cause even more damage in the long run. When blow-drying your hair while it’s wet, it is weaker and easier to break. It is recommended to use heat protectant spray before you use any heat product.

4. Brushing your hair when it’s wet
When your hair is wet, the strands tend to be the most fragile. Try not to play rough when you’re brushing your wet hair as it is more susceptible to breakage. Maybe try to use a wide-tooth comb and work on your hair from the ends to up.
5. Using too much conditioner isn’t good
Using too much conditioner or not washing it off properly can weigh the down your hair and make it look limp and greasy. Hence, it’s important to rinse your hair twice. It’s best to condition your ends only as your roots produces natural oil.
